I'm about to choose my 2017 accessories...
So, I'm about to buy a 2017 BRZ (previously owned a 2016 BRZ).
My 2016 had an STI front lip, STI spoiler, tower bar, draw stiffener, STI start button, Duracon knob, Short shift assembly. It looked awesome! I want my car to look badass, and drive badass I can't go RB Kit because Australia is a backwater when it comes to car modification laws. I'll hopefully go some coilovers and fat ass 18x9s (either te37, ze40 or rs05rr) so not really interested in the wheels/springs that the factory offers. Currently my "must haves" are going to be the STI start button, Duracon + short shift assembly. I'm guessing there are better/cheaper alternatives to the body kit, and towerbars. Is this correct? Which factory accessories are worthy? |
